Key findings
Tribunal's reasoningThis was a Rule 21 judgment in which Employment Judge Camp found that the respondent, Full Fat Productions Limited, had made an unauthorised deduction from Mr K Taylor's wages in June 2018.
The tribunal ordered the respondent to pay the claimant the gross sum of £988.19. The hearing listed for 29 January 2019 was cancelled.
